javascript - 我怎样才能转到另一个 HTML 文件

标签 javascript html

由于某些原因,document.location.hrefwindow.location.href window.location.replace 不工作,我现在正在使用 localhost,我不知道如何将它重定向到另一个网页。我尝试在前面添加 http://,它仍然不起作用,我尝试将其重定向到另一个在线网站,它也没有用。我已经阅读了很多线程并尝试了它们,但它们都不适合我。

var loginBut = document.getElementById("RDbtn1");
loginBut.addEventListener("click", checklogin);
function check(){
    document.location.href =  "http://localhost/some/directory/here";
    alert(document.location.origin + '/some/directory');  // I just use this to know that the button is being pressed.

}

html:

  <!-- some code here-->
<li><button class="login1" id="RDbtn1">LOGIN</button></li>
  <!-- some code here -->

最佳答案

我相信你应该重定向到特定的 html 页面并且应该给出你的本地主机应用程序正在运行的端口

document.location.href =  "http://localhost:8080/some/directory/here/file.html";

关于javascript - 我怎样才能转到另一个 HTML 文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/66838866/

相关文章:

javascript - 如何在javascript var中添加超链接?

javascript - 谁提供了 Express 中间件中的 next() 功能?

javascript - Django - 从 {{STATIC_URL}} 转换为 {% static %}

css - 使用CSS将悬停状态分配给数据ID

javascript - 单击输入字段的填充将光标设置在行首,而不是行尾

java - 如何在 Play! 的 JavaScript 模板中访问消息?框架?

javascript - Kendo Validate - 忽略特定输入

javascript - 如何在Angular JS中获取数组元素?

javascript - 所有元素 ID 的 TweenMax 重用函数

html - 尝试在 div 中平均分配元素以填充之间的空间